1. Carmel-by-the-Sea, California
Carmel-by-the-Sea embodies charm and tranquility. Narrow streets lined with art galleries, boutique shops, and cozy cafes make strolling the town an immersive experience. The nearby Carmel Beach offers wide stretches of sand, ideal for reflective walks or reading under the sun. Fine dining and fresh seafood elevate the experience, while local festivals bring subtle cultural energy without overwhelming the serenity.
Visitors can explore the scenic 17-Mile Drive, where panoramic ocean views meet rugged coastline. Its small-town feel ensures privacy and relaxation while still offering opportunities for adventure and discovery.
2. Rovinj, Croatia
Rovinj presents a picture-perfect coastal escape in the Adriatic. Cobbled streets wind past pastel-colored houses and lead to bustling squares and quiet harbor corners. The town balances calm and activity, with morning markets offering fresh produce and seafood while historic architecture captivates visitors at every turn.
The nearby beaches invite sunbathing, swimming, and gentle water sports. Cafes along the marina provide places to enjoy local cuisine and watch fishing boats return. Evening strolls offer a magical view of the sun setting over the water, which reflects golden light on the town’s centuries-old walls.
3. Port Isaac, England
Port Isaac offers a quintessentially British coastal experience. Famous for its fishing heritage and narrow lanes, it evokes a sense of stepping back in time. The small harbor and surrounding cliffs create scenic walks that refresh the mind and body.
Visitors should take time to enjoy these experiences in Port Isaac:
- Exploring narrow streets and historic cottages
- Discovering hidden coves and quiet beaches
- Sampling local seafood at family-run pubs.
Each activity encourages relaxation and connection with the town’s unique character. The peaceful atmosphere and timeless charm make Port Isaac a perfect destination for those seeking a slower pace of life.
4. Sayulita, Mexico
Sayulita offers a vibrant yet relaxing escape on Mexico’s Pacific coast. Colorful streets, bohemian shops, and a strong surfing culture create a unique energy without overshadowing the laid-back vibe. Beaches stretch for miles, perfect for sunbathing, casual strolls, or beginner surfing lessons.
Local restaurants serve fresh ceviche, tacos, and tropical fruit drinks, and they encourage slow dining and enjoyment of the surroundings. Sayulita also has a creative arts scene, with galleries, workshops, and markets that reflect local traditions and craftsmanship.
5. Sète, France

Sète combines seaside charm with rich cultural life. The town is built on canals, which creates a picturesque setting that encourages leisurely walks along the water. Fishing boats bring daily catches to markets, while local bakeries and cafes offer authentic French flavors.
The beaches are accessible yet uncrowded; they provide space for reading, swimming, or simply enjoying the sun. Seasonal festivals celebrate music, seafood, and local traditions and offer entertainment without compromising the town’s peaceful atmosphere.
